Output 0e50496d75dba1923e20f257e3718415cc6f3c0845459bc1c06f8cc117be4299:0

value
169600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 593ecbfd414b3d9b468536604d326ec6faab5af4 OP_EQUAL
address
39puHpM3CMwSwuky5KTdV2ATRSfX2LZtfd
transaction
0e50496d75dba1923e20f257e3718415cc6f3c0845459bc1c06f8cc117be4299
confirmations
277769
spent
true